Océ and manroland announce global strategic alliance
Worldwide cooperation in inkjet-based digital printing solutions for the graphic arts industry
Venlo, The Netherlands, 1 December 2010 - Océ, the world's leading manufacturer of high-performance printing systems for digital continuous feed printing, and manroland AG, one of the world’s leading suppliers of offset printing systems, will from 2011 on offer the market total digital printing solutions aimed at the graphic arts industry - all of these being optimal solutions from a single source. The companies will supply solutions that cover all of the manufacturing steps within the graphic arts industry by combining print data management and digital and offset printing as well as postprocessing.
Main advantages for printers
As the No. 1 in digital full-color continuous feed printing, Océ possesses decades of experience in the fields of system integration, workflow management and variable high-performance data printing. In its turn, as one of the world’s leading suppliers of offset printing systems, manroland has profound expertise in the development and manufacturing of high-productivity offset technologies as well as in the associated postprocessing and finishing systems. The main beneficiaries of the cooperation will be printing operations who are selecting future-oriented technology and workflow solutions to be employed within their company after being jointly advised by manroland and Océ.
Inkjet production supplements offset printing
Inkjet production systems are increasingly being used as a supplement to offset printing for small runs and just-in-time production. Here they offer a cost advantages, and permit, in conjunction with appropriate postprocessing, fast throughput times. Areas of application include books, advertising inserts, catalogs and brochures.

About Océ
Océ is one of the leading providers of document management and printing for professionals. The Océ offering includes office printing and copying systems, high speed digital production printers and wide format printing systems for both technical documentation and color display graphics. Océ is also a foremost supplier of document management outsourcing. Many of the Fortune Global 500 companies and leading commercial printers are Océ customers. The company was founded in 1877. With headquarters in Venlo, The Netherlands, Océ is active in over 100 countries and employs more than 20,000 people worldwide. Total revenues in fiscal 2010 amounted to approximately €2.7 billion.
